Antico Pizza Napoletana, Atlanta

Antico Pizza Napoletana is a wildly energetic Neapolitan pizza institution where blistered wood-fired crust, communal dining chaos, and pure Italian obsession converge inside one of the most iconic restaurants in the city.

Set along Hemphill Avenue NW near Northside Drive and just steps from Georgia Tech and West Midtown's industrial corridor, this legendary pizza destination carries the unmistakable atmosphere of a place shaped by lines out the door, flour dust floating through open kitchens, and guests crowding communal tables while pizzas emerge blistering hot from roaring ovens every few minutes. Antico Pizza Napoletana helped redefine Atlanta's pizza scene by introducing an uncompromisingly authentic Neapolitan approach rooted directly in traditional Italian technique and atmosphere.

The restaurant's philosophy revolves around simplicity executed perfectly. Dough fermentation, high-temperature wood-fired ovens, imported ingredients, restrained toppings, and rapid-fire cooking times all follow the traditional Neapolitan model where texture, balance, and ingredient integrity matter more than excess customization. Pizzas emerge intentionally imperfect, blistered edges, softer centers, charred crust, molten cheese, because authenticity takes priority over standardized uniformity. The dining room itself mirrors that same philosophy. Crowded communal seating, visible ovens, exposed kitchen intensity, and tightly packed tables create an atmosphere closer to a bustling Southern Italian pizzeria than a conventional American restaurant. Antico Pizza Napoletana works best as a highly social lunch or dinner stop folded naturally into a broader West Midtown or Georgia Tech itinerary.

Arrive hungry and expect energy. The restaurant works best when embraced fully on its own terms: crowded rooms, fast-moving lines, communal seating, and pizzas arriving almost too hot to touch directly from the oven. Order multiple pies across the table because the experience reveals itself most clearly through variety and shared eating. Margherita pizzas, simpler tomato-forward builds, richer cheese combinations, and charred crust textures all showcase different dimensions of the kitchen's precision and restraint.
